How To Pull 2003 Toyota Camry With Automatic Transmission Behind A Motorhome
Question:
I just bought a Jayco Melbourne L with the Mercedes chassis. I have a 2003 Toyota Camry automatic 4cyl. What kind of towing setup would be best to tow car behind RV?
asked by: Dave
Expert Reply:
According to Toyota the 2003 Toyota Camry automatic is not designed to be flat towed behind a motor home with all 4 wheels on the ground to avoid damage to the vehicle's transmission. The only way to flat tow the Toyota Camry automatic is with a tow dolly.
I recommend the Demco Kar Kaddy X Tow Dolly with Disc Brakes part # DM9713093 because of it's disc brake system. There is not a need to add an electric brake controller to the motor home like with the other options. The Kar Kaddy is pre-wired so the dolly is all you need to tow the Camry behind the motor home compared to the other options that require extra wiring. The Demco Kar Kaddy has a 4-pole flat so you can use Pollak 7 Pole to 4 Way Connector Adapter # PK12716 to plug the Kar Kaddy into the motor home's 7-way. This option is actually less costly compared to flat towing with a tow bar because you need less parts.
